Choosing the Right Blinds for Tilt-and-Turn uPVC Windows
From Best to Least Recommended Tilt-and-turn windows require blinds that can move with the window sash when it tilts inward or swings open. Because of this unique mechanism, not all blinds are suitable. The most practical solutions are those that attach directly to the window rather than the wall . 1️⃣ Perfect Fit Blinds Perfect Fit blinds are widely considered the most suitable option for tilt-and-turn windows .
